Mo matou | About Hohepa
Working at Hohepa is different from the average; you become part of our community of people, staff, volunteers, and contractors who all have a common goal - helping people to reach their full potential and lead enriched and meaningful lives in a holistic, supportive environment. We are a community leader providing services and support for people living with an intellectual disability to live their best lives and find a valued place in our society. Inspired by Dr Rudolf Steiner's principles of anthroposophy, we seek to understand each person and situation as unique, not a one size fits all philosophy.
Mo te turanga | About the Role
The role involves planning and delivering a range of activities within the LEAP programme, with a focus on delivering in line with EGL principles ensuring that the people being supported have opportunities and access to experiences that allow for learning and development. You will be energetic, empathetic, and able to work alongside people that we support while focusing on creating a life of rich and diverse experiences.
You will be aware of others and be able to read situations, problem solve, and apply boundaries or offer space. Daily tasks include supporting with activities, maintaining the upkeep of the services, and working in a collaborative team. You will be passionate about providing encouragement, developing skills, and quality experiences for all while maintaining a flexible team member attitude and the ability to work seamlessly together. If you are looking for a new challenge, this could be the opportunity for you!
This position's salary scale is set by pay equity and depends on qualification level, paying between $23.15 and $28.25 per hour.
Nga haora kua tohua | Rostered hours:
Monday to Friday 8:30am to 4:00pm
Total Hours per fortnight: 75
This position is a fixed-term employment starting immediately and ending on April 28th, 2025.
